Output e8428250d3f682df3d5b715d845ddd9a4f65601db4781c25c0e1c81a5be656bd:0

value
2000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b51604ca29fb6532c12507ac36f85270ae653d58 OP_EQUALVERIFY OP_CHECKSIG
address
1HWVgcGb6pZ7Zdz9VkcKWkuy8sJwcaxNat
transaction
e8428250d3f682df3d5b715d845ddd9a4f65601db4781c25c0e1c81a5be656bd
spent
true